This knife is not a late original with an added motto, it is a 100% fake:

- scabbard with lip and missing rivet (already said by SS man)
- writing and positioning of the motto is not good
- diamond is a bad copy.
- makersmark is on the obverse side with the motto, only a few makers did that.
